Soil Moisture and Plant Sensors

Soil sensors are often the first smart tool gardeners adopt. These devices insert directly into the soil near plant roots and operate quietly. They measure moisture, light exposure, and temperature in real time. Some models also provide basic nutrient trend data. Information is transmitted to mobile apps that display clear, easy-to-read charts.

Products such as the Koubachi Wi-Fi Plant Sensor gained popularity by combining soil data with plant-specific guidance. Users receive alerts when water levels drop or light exposure decreases. More affordable Bluetooth sensors offer similar moisture and temperature monitoring and can be moved between pots as needed.

One of the greatest benefits of these sensors is knowing when not to water. Many plants fail due to excessive care rather than neglect. Sensors help prevent this by providing clear, objective feedback, increasing confidence for both new and experienced gardeners.

Smart Gardening Tools

How Sensors Improve Plant Care

Before sensors, gardeners relied on touch and observation to judge soil moisture. While sometimes effective, this approach often led to inconsistent results. Sensors replace guesswork with measurable data, helping users detect dry cycles earlier.

Over time, gardeners begin to notice seasonal light shifts and watering patterns. Apps automatically log data over days and weeks, enabling better decisions about plant placement, pot size, and care routines. As experience grows, users develop stronger instincts alongside the data.

Smart Irrigation Controllers

Smart irrigation controllers replace traditional sprinkler timers with connected systems. These units mount near existing irrigation panels and connect to Wi-Fi and weather services during setup. Controllers automatically adjust watering schedules based on rainfall, temperature, and climate conditions.

Rachio Smart Sprinkler Controllers are widely used for residential lawns, allowing users to define zones for grass, garden beds, or shrubs. The system automatically skips watering after rainfall. Orbit B-hyve controllers offer similar functionality at more accessible price points.

These systems reduce water waste without adding effort. Users avoid watering during storms, and many report lower water bills after installation.

Real-World Lawn and Garden Applications

Once installed, homeowners set initial schedules and allow the controller to make ongoing adjustments. Mobile apps display watering logs, helping identify leaks or dry zones. Zones can be fine-tuned digitally rather than manually.

Smart controllers support both lawn sprinklers and drip irrigation systems. Flower beds receive lighter watering than turf, promoting healthier root development over time.

Robotic Lawn Mowers

Robotic lawn mowers automate grass cutting using programmed paths or GPS navigation. Users schedule mowing through mobile apps, and the mower operates quietly before returning to its charging dock.

Navimow models rely on GPS instead of boundary wires, while Gardena Sileno City mowers are designed for smaller yards. Husqvarna Automower units accommodate larger properties.

The primary advantage is time savings. Users avoid manual mowing in heat, while lawns remain consistently trimmed through frequent, light cuts.

Handheld Electric Pollinators

Indoor and greenhouse growers often face reduced pollination due to the absence of insects. Handheld electric pollinators address this challenge directly.

These devices generate high-frequency vibrations that mimic bee wing movement. The vibrations release pollen onto a small collection surface, which can then be transferred manually to other flowers.

Handheld electric pollinators are commonly used for tomatoes, peppers, beans, peas, eggplant, and strawberries. Many users report yield increases of up to 30 percent over time. This tool appeals to growers seeking consistent results without depending on natural pollinators.

Indoor Hydroponic Garden Systems

Indoor hydroponic systems are designed for people who want to grow plants without soil or outdoor limitations. These systems cultivate herbs, leafy greens, and small vegetables using water mixed with nutrients. Roots remain in controlled environments where moisture and oxygen stay balanced.

Most systems include a water reservoir, circulation mechanism, and integrated grow lights. The lighting simulates natural daylight cycles, allowing plants to grow steadily even in low-light rooms. Water circulates gently around the roots, providing consistent nourishment.

Maintenance is minimal. Users typically refill water every one to two weeks and add nutrients as directed. There is no digging, weeding, or heavy cleanup.

Hydroponic systems work well in kitchens, apartments, offices, and shared spaces. Common crops include basil, mint, lettuce, and small peppers. Stable indoor conditions allow predictable growth year-round, making these systems suitable for beginners and busy households.

Limits and Expectations

Smart gardening tools do not correct poor soil quality or choose appropriate plants for specific climates. Human decisions remain essential. These tools provide guidance rather than control.

Batteries require replacement, and stable internet connections improve functionality. These minor tasks accompany the convenience offered.

Frequently Asked Questions (FAQ)

Are smart gardening tools difficult to set up?
Most tools arrive ready to use, with app-guided setup requiring minimal time.

Do these tools work for beginners?
Yes. Beginners often benefit the most, as apps explain plant needs clearly and reduce common mistakes.

Do smart tools require constant internet access?
Some features rely on Wi-Fi, but many tools continue functioning offline. Bluetooth sensors work locally, and irrigation schedules persist during outages.

Are these tools safe around children and pets?
Most products include safety features. Robotic mowers stop blades when lifted, and indoor systems use enclosed lighting and low heat.

Do smart tools replace traditional gardening skills?
No. They support timing and consistency, while gardeners remain responsible for plant choice and care.

How long do batteries last?
Battery life ranges from several months to over a year, depending on usage. Apps usually provide low-battery alerts.

Are smart tools worth it for small gardens or balconies?
Even a single sensor or indoor system can reduce plant loss, making them cost-effective for small spaces.
